Frequently Asked Questions about resorts in Luzon

  • What are the top attractions in Luzon, Philippines?

    Luzon boasts incredible diversity! For history buffs, Intramuros in Manila is a must-see, a walled city dating back to the Spanish colonial era. The Banaue Rice Terraces, a UNESCO World Heritage site, are breathtaking feats of engineering and agricultural ingenuity. Then there's Baguio City, a mountain resort known for its cool climate and pine forests, offering a refreshing escape from the tropical heat. Further north, you'll find the volcanic landscapes of Taal Volcano and Mount Pinatubo, offering stunning views and opportunities for hiking and adventure.

  • Are there particular times of year when Luzon, Philippines’ landscapes or wildlife undergo striking seasonal changes?

    Yes, Luzon experiences distinct wet and dry seasons. The wet season (June to November) brings abundant rainfall, lush greenery, and waterfalls at their fullest. The dry season (December to May) is ideal for hiking and outdoor activities, with clear skies and less rain. Wildlife activity can vary depending on the season and specific location.

  • What are the lesser-known but fascinating attractions in Luzon, Philippines?

    Beyond the well-trodden paths, Luzon holds many hidden gems. The Callao Caves in Peñablanca, Cagayan offer a fascinating glimpse into the region's geological history. The Hundred Islands National Park in Pangasinan provides a stunning archipelago to explore. Numerous smaller towns offer unique cultural experiences and opportunities to interact with local communities, away from the tourist crowds.
